小爱音箱音乐解锁终极指南:告别会员限制,实现免费听歌自由
小爱音箱音乐解锁终极指南:告别会员限制,实现免费听歌自由
【免费下载链接】xiaomusic使用小爱音箱播放音乐,音乐使用 yt-dlp 下载。项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ic
还在为小爱音箱的音乐会员限制而烦恼吗?"小爱同学,播放周杰伦的《七里香》"——"抱歉,这首歌需要开通音乐会员才能播放"。这样的对话是否每天都在你的家中上演?今天,我将为你介绍一个革命性的解决方案:XiaoMusic,一个完全开源的小爱音箱音乐解锁工具,让你彻底告别会员限制,实现真正的免费听歌自由!
XiaoMusic是一个基于Python开发的开源项目,通过智能拦截小爱音箱的语音指令,使用yt-dlp引擎从多个平台下载音乐资源,建立本地音乐库,从而实现免费播放全网音乐。这个项目不仅解决了小爱音箱的音乐版权问题,还提供了丰富的自定义功能,让你的智能音箱真正变得"智能"起来。
为什么你需要XiaoMusic?
传统方案的痛点
在使用小爱音箱的过程中,你可能遇到过这些问题:
- 会员经济绑架:不开通会员就无法播放热门歌曲
- 平台曲库有限:内置音乐平台经常下架歌曲
- 功能扩展缺失:无法接入个人音乐库,缺乏个性化定制
- 蓝牙连接不便:音质损失严重,且无法语音控制
XiaoMusic的解决方案优势
XiaoMusic采用独特的"语音指令拦截+智能下载+本地播放"三重架构,具有以下核心优势:
- 全网资源覆盖:基于yt-dlp引擎,支持从多个平台获取音乐资源
- 本地缓存保障:下载的音乐保存在本地,实现零等待播放体验
- 完整语音控制:支持所有基础播放控制指令,无缝衔接
- 完全免费使用:一次性部署,终身免费,无需持续付费
快速开始:5分钟完成部署
Docker极简部署(推荐)
对于大多数用户来说,Docker部署是最简单快捷的方式:
docker run -p 58090:8090 \ -v /home/你的用户名/music:/app/music \ -v /home/你的用户名/conf:/app/conf \ hanxi/xiaomusic部署完成后,访问 http://你的服务器IP:58090 即可进入Web设置页面。
源码安装方案
如果你喜欢更灵活的配置方式,可以选择源码安装:
git clone https://gitcode.com/GitHub_Trending/xia/xiaomusic cd xiaomusic pip install -r requirements.txt python xiaomusic.py核心配置指南
基础配置要点
首次使用时,你需要配置以下几个关键参数:
- 小米账号密码:用于连接你的小爱音箱设备
- 音乐存储路径:指定本地音乐文件的存储位置
- 网络端口:设置服务监听的端口号
配置文件详解
项目提供了详细的配置文件示例:config-example.json,你可以复制并修改它:
cp config-example.json config.json主要配置项说明:
account和password:你的小米账号和密码music_path:音乐文件存储路径port:服务监听端口(默认8090)key_word_dict:自定义语音指令字典
核心功能详解
基础播放控制
XiaoMusic支持丰富的语音控制指令:
- 播放歌曲:播放本地已下载的歌曲
- 播放歌曲+歌名:例如"播放歌曲周杰伦晴天"
- 上一首/下一首:切换歌曲
- 关机/停止播放:停止播放
播放模式切换
- 单曲循环:重复播放当前歌曲
- 全部循环:循环播放所有歌曲
- 随机播放:随机顺序播放
歌单管理功能
- 播放歌单+目录名:例如"播放歌单流行音乐"
- 播放歌单收藏:播放收藏的歌单
- 加入收藏:将当前歌曲加入收藏
- 取消收藏:从收藏中移除歌曲
隐藏玩法
你知道吗?对小爱同学说"播放歌曲小猪佩奇的故事",XiaoMusic会先下载小猪佩奇的故事音频,然后再播放。这个功能非常适合有小孩的家庭!
进阶使用技巧
自定义语音指令
XiaoMusic支持完全自定义语音指令,你可以在配置文件中添加自己的指令:
"user_key_word_dict": { "晨间唤醒": "exec#code1(\"播放晨间音乐\")", "晚餐时光": "exec#code1(\"播放轻音乐\")", "运动激励": "exec#code1(\"播放动感歌曲\")", "睡前安眠": "exec#code1(\"播放白噪音\")" }多设备协同管理
如果你家有多个小爱音箱,XiaoMusic可以统一管理:
- 客厅音箱播放背景音乐
- 卧室音箱同步儿童故事
- 厨房音箱语音控制播放
网络歌单功能
XiaoMusic支持网络歌单功能,你可以配置JSON格式的歌单,支持电台和歌曲,也可以直接使用别人分享的链接。项目还提供了M3U文件格式转换工具,可以很方便地把M3U电台文件转换成网络歌单格式的JSON文件。
支持的设备列表
XiaoMusic已经测试支持以下小爱音箱型号:
| 型号 | 设备名称 |
|---|---|
| L06A | 小爱音箱 |
| L07A | Redmi小爱音箱 Play |
| S12/S12A/MDZ-25-DA | 小米AI音箱 |
| LX5A | 小爱音箱 万能遥控版 |
| LX05 | 小爱音箱Play(2019款) |
| L15A | 小米AI音箱(第二代) |
| L16A | Xiaomi Sound |
| L17A | Xiaomi Sound Pro |
如果你的设备不在列表中,可以尝试使用,大多数小爱音箱应该都能正常工作。
常见问题解答
Q1: 部署后无法连接小爱音箱怎么办?
A: 首先检查小米账号密码是否正确,确保网络环境稳定。如果还是无法连接,可以查看日志文件排查问题。
Q2: 下载的歌曲音质如何保证?
A: XiaoMusic支持多种音频格式,包括MP3、FLAC、WAV等。你可以根据需要选择最佳音质方案,项目还提供了音频转换功能。
Q3: 如何确保长期稳定使用?
A: 建议定期更新项目版本,关注社区动态。项目提供了详细的官方文档:docs/index.md,遇到问题可以先查阅文档。
Q4: 是否支持海外歌曲资源?
A: 基于yt-dlp引擎,XiaoMusic支持全球主流平台的音乐资源下载。
Q5: 安全方面有什么需要注意的?
A: 如果配置了公网访问,请一定要开启密码登录,并设置复杂的密码。不要在公共场所的WiFi环境下使用,否则可能造成小米账号密码泄露。
用户真实反馈
家庭用户张女士:"自从安装了XiaoMusic,孩子每天都能听到不同的童话故事,再也不用为会员费发愁了。操作简单,效果显著!"
音乐爱好者李先生:"作为一个资深乐迷,现在可以随心点播各种冷门歌曲,这才是智能音箱应有的样子。特别感谢开发者的辛勤付出!"
技术爱好者王先生:"项目的代码结构清晰,文档完善,让我这个Python新手也能轻松理解原理并参与贡献。"
项目特色与优势
开源免费
XiaoMusic采用MIT开源协议,完全免费使用,代码透明可审计。
社区活跃
项目拥有活跃的社区支持,遇到问题可以在GitHub Issues中寻求帮助,或者加入QQ群、微信群与其他用户交流。
持续更新
开发者持续维护项目,定期发布新版本,修复问题并添加新功能。
扩展性强
项目支持插件开发,你可以根据自己的需求编写自定义插件,实现更多个性化功能。
开始你的免费音乐之旅
现在你已经了解了XiaoMusic的所有核心功能和使用方法,是时候开始你的免费音乐之旅了!无论你是技术小白还是资深玩家,XiaoMusic都能为你提供完美的解决方案。
记住,智能家居的真正价值在于让生活更便捷,而不是增加额外的负担。通过XiaoMusic,你可以重新掌控自己的音乐体验,让小爱音箱真正成为懂你音乐品味的智能伙伴。
不要再被会员限制困扰,立即开始部署XiaoMusic,享受真正的免费音乐自由吧!如果你在部署过程中遇到任何问题,欢迎查阅项目文档或加入社区讨论,我们随时为你提供帮助。
【免费下载链接】xiaomusic使用小爱音箱播放音乐,音乐使用 yt-dlp 下载。项目地址: https://gitcode.com/GitHub_Trending/xia/xiaomusic
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
